Wintertide | Light Art Installations
Port Angeles Fine Arts Center is seeking applications for the 2026 Wintertide Light Art Experience, an outdoor exhibition held in Webster’s Woods Sculpture Park. Open to individual artists or artist teams, this opportunity invites the creation of durable, light-based sculptures inspired by the theme Nature After Dark—Illuminating the Darkness Through Connection. Selected works will be displayed November 27, 2026 through January 1, 2027, alongside an established sculpture collection and viewed by a wide public audience during nightly hours and the December 12, 2026 Wintertide Festival. With stipends ranging from $300–$1,500, this is an opportunity to showcase innovative work in a unique forest environment. Applications are accepted on a rolling basis through September 8.
Due Date
September 8, 2026
Hoffman Center for the Arts Exhibition
The Hoffman Center for the Arts is reviewing submissions for the 2027 gallery exhibition season and helps shape what audiences see in our gallery. In 2027, we’re showing 2D and 3D gallery work only: photography, painting, drawing, printmaking, fiber, craft, ceramics, and sculpture that can be displayed in our small gallery. We welcome submissions from all over the Pacific Northwest, including artists who live or work in Tillamook, Clatsop, or Lincoln County. We do not prioritize submissions from artists who live or work in Manzanita. We especially welcome submissions from LGBTQIA+ artists, Black artists, Indigenous artists, artists of color, working-class artists, artists with disabilities, and others whose backgrounds or perspectives have been historically underrepresented in galleries in the Pacific Northwest.
Due Date
December 31, 2026
Rain Shadow Artisans
Rain Shadow Artisans offers an exciting opportunity for local artists to share and sell their creations while connecting with the community. As a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ization, Rain Shadow Artisans is dedicated to bringing artists and community members together through a shared appreciation of locally created artwork. We invite local artists to join our dynamic group, showcase their work, engage with the public, and become part of a vibrant creative community. We will host 7 shows June-December. More details will be available on our website as we travel through Spring. Note, there is no due date as we accept applications all year long.
